Vertically integrated projects (VIP) programme
programme
The vertically integrated projects (VIP) programme is an opportunity to engage in ongoing research at Malmö University, test your knowledge and contribute what you have learned on research or research methodology in a real research team.
You will get to collaborate with other students and researchers in teams, practice planning and discuss the research process. Practice generic research skills and theoretical skills within the research field of the team. All while “doing” actual research. In most cases, especially if you continue for several semesters, you will also gain experience in training you mentorship and leadership skills.
About vertically integrated projects
VIP provide a multi-year, multidisciplinary approach to learning that is project-based, innovative, and research-active. It is an opportunity to practice professional skills while making real-world contributions in a research context. You will be working with researchers and students from all levels of study.
